Abstract
A superheterodyne receiver includes an A/D converter for converting an IF signal to a stream of samples at a sampling frequency that is four times the IF and a splitter that splits the stream of samples into a first set of even samples and a second set of odd samples. A first quadrature demodulator demodulates just the first set of even samples to produce one of real (I) and imaginary (Q) components of a complex signal at one half of the sampling frequency, and a second, parallel quadrature demodulator demodulates just the second set of odd samples to produce the other of the I and Q components. The demodulated first set is filtered using a first subset of filter coefficients, and the demodulated second set is filtered using a second subset of filter coefficients. The filter outputs correspond to a baseband complex signal. The technology disclosed reduces overall hardware complexity and operating frequency by a factor of two or more.
